Understanding Corrosion Mechanisms and Prevention Strategies

Corrosion processes are complex interactions between metals, their environment, and time. These phenomena can result in significant damage of materials, impacting infrastructure, tools, and even human health. To effectively combat corrosion, it's crucial to comprehend the underlying factors. A variety of methods exist for corrosion prevention, ranging from material selection to environmental manipulation.

A common approach involves utilizing protective films to insulate the metal surface from corrosive substances. Other strategies incorporate cathodic protection, which utilizes an external flow to prevent the corrosion of a metal structure. Furthermore, careful assessment of materials and their environment can help identify potential corrosion concerns early on, allowing for timely intervention.

The Science

Corrosion, a pervasive process that degrades metallic materials, poses a significant challenge across various industries. To mitigate this deterioration, scientists have investigated the science of corrosion inhibition and protective films. Protective films act as a shield against corrosive agents, preventing the extent of corrosion.
